l337raceryo, I have the 180HP Turbo Lite mated to the only tranny you can get with it...the plain ol' automatic (no autostick). Adding S1 gives you almost a 60HP increase - 1/3 more power - for just over $300 and you can install it yourself in 30 minutes including putting away your tools and doing the quick learn procedure on the tranny. You could add one of the super cool intake setups that Adam is selling for around the same money, but it won't get you the jump in HP Stage 1 will. You could spend a lot more on a really cool exhaust, but it won't come close to giving you 60 extra ponies.

You've taken out the silencers in the stock airbox, maybe you could add the BrandX intake pipe for about $100 or so.....but you won't come anywhere near the increase you'll get with Stage 1.

As for differences in the basic auto trans and the autostick, I believe it's just a little bit of programming and the extra slots......don't quote me on that just yet, but I have a VERY reliable source (he wrenches these trannies for a living!) so I'll report back as soon as I know something definitive.
